Five various drone forms were being distinguished. The fastened-wing has an extremely diverse style and design as compared with another drones; it's two wings for an aerodynamic condition that makes it look like an airplane. A single-rotor helicopter has one major rotor on top of it and one particular smaller rotor at the end of the tail, it appears like a helicopter. The quadcopter can be a style which includes four rotors; two of them rotate during the clockwise way and the other kinds while in the counter-clockwise path.

Drones Geared up with complex sensors, cameras, and GPS systems deliver farmers with priceless insights into their fields problems. These aerial automobiles can seize high-resolution visuals, thermal info, and multispectral imagery, providing an extensive watch of crop wellness, soil moisture amounts, and pest infestations. By exactly mapping these parameters, farmers can tailor their steps, which include targeted pesticide application or irrigation, leading to optimized useful resource allocation and increased effectiveness. This precision not just boosts crop yields but in addition minimizes enter prices and lowers environmental effects by minimizing the usage of fertilizers and substances. What's more, drones help timely interventions, permitting farmers to deal with issues immediately, therefore mitigating potential losses. In essence, The mixing of drones in agriculture revolutionizes classic farming tactics, empowering farmers to help make info-driven conclusions and attain sustainable agricultural creation. on the list of critical advantages of drones in precision farming is their power to Obtain data speedily and at scale. ordinarily, farmers relied on ground-dependent observations or satellite imagery, which often lacked the resolution or timeliness required for powerful selection-creating. Drones, Then again, can cover huge areas in the fraction of the time, capturing detailed details with unparalleled accuracy. This wealth of data will allow farmers to make educated conclusions personalized to precise sections of their fields.
